About Stuart Hood

Stuart Hood is a scholar working on Radiology, Nuclear Medicine and Imaging, Cardiology and Cardiovascular Medicine, Psychiatry and Mental health, Endocrinology, Diabetes and Metabolism and Surgery, having authored 38 papers that have together received 1.2k indexed citations. Recurring topics across this work include Cardiac Imaging and Diagnostics (14 papers), Advanced MRI Techniques and Applications (6 papers), Acute Myocardial Infarction Research (5 papers), Cardiovascular Function and Risk Factors (4 papers), Sexual function and dysfunction studies (3 papers), Cardiac electrophysiology and arrhythmias (2 papers), Hormonal and reproductive studies (2 papers) and Coronary Interventions and Diagnostics (2 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(555 citations), Radiology, Nuclear Medicine and Imaging (526 citations), Emergency Medicine (57 citations), Surgery (268 citations) and Internal Medicine (13 citations). Stuart Hood has collaborated with scholars based in United Kingdom, Australia and United States. Frequent co-authors include Colin Berry, Margaret McEntegart, Keith G. Oldroyd, Mitchell Lindsay, Hany Eteiba, Stuart Watkins, Mark C. Petrie, David Carrick, Ian Ford and Ahmed Mahrous. Their work appears in journals such as Circulation Cardiovascular Imaging, Journal of the American Heart Association, International Journal of Cardiology, European Heart Journal and Circulation Cardiovascular Interventions.
